CI note for new contractors on the StallCount project. The occupancy-feed pipeline fails most often at the fixture stage: the simulated Bremerhollow garage data expires after 30 days, so regenerate fixtures before blaming your change. If the integration step times out, the mock sensor gateway probably didn't start; rerun the job once before digging in. Lint failures on the feed schema are real — fix them, don't suppress. When you escalate a red build to the pipeline channel, always paste the build token shown below.

session token of tajef-bageg = htk21_5d90d574934f3ccae6437

Before your new starter arrives at the Drayfield campus, confirm their seat on the morning shuttle from the Harlow Green park-and-ride. The shuttle-bus gate at the east perimeter is staffed only between 07:00 and 09:30, so time the pickup carefully. Walk the starter through the gate procedure on day one: present the welcome letter, sign the arrivals sheet, and wait for the marshal's nod. Until their permanent pass is printed, they should use the temporary gate code shown below.

badge for tageg-bajep: bdg-ZR-3

Facilities ticket — front desk visitor handling, Ardenvale House.

Team assistants: until the new check-in kiosk is installed next month, all visitors must be logged in the paper register at the desk. Collect photo ID, issue a dated visitor sticker, and note the host's name. Visitors may not be left unescorted past the lobby turnstiles. If a host is delayed more than fifteen minutes, assistants may escort the visitor to the second-floor waiting room themselves. For that purpose, use the escort badge code below.

turnstile pass: bdg-FVNQRS-72965873